Enjoy over 36 miles of beautiful trails on the Greenway while maintaining its beauty. With 2100 acres we are always working to keep the trails and roads trash-free. Trash is most prevalent along roads (Springfield, Old Nation, Hwy 21), around ponds and under overpasses.
